Subject: [PATCH] iproute: Dump UDP sockets via netlink
Date: Fri, 09 Dec 2011 20:26:27 +0400	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<4EE236B3.2090808@parallels.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<4EE23561.5020804@parallels.com>

Since for UDP the same binary API is used, just rename tcp_show_netlink and others
into inet_show_netlink (and others) and wire the calls into udp-related paths.

Applies on top of previous patch with support for the new sock_diag api.

diff -u b/misc/ss.c b/misc/ss.c
--- b/misc/ss.c
+++ b/misc/ss.c
@@ -1410,7 +1410,7 @@
 	}
 }
 
-static int tcp_show_sock(struct nlmsghdr *nlh, struct filter *f)
+static int inet_show_sock(struct nlmsghdr *nlh, struct filter *f)
 {
 	struct inet_diag_msg *r = NLMSG_DATA(nlh);
 	struct tcpstat s;
@@ -1474,7 +1474,7 @@
 	return 0;
 }
 
-static int __tcp_show_netlink(struct filter *f, FILE *dump_fp, int family, int socktype)
+static int __inet_show_netlink(struct filter *f, FILE *dump_fp, int family, int socktype)
 {
 	int fd;
 	struct sockaddr_nl nladdr;
@@ -1590,7 +1590,7 @@
 				return 0;
 			}
 			if (!dump_fp) {
-				err = tcp_show_sock(h, NULL);
+				err = inet_show_sock(h, NULL);
 				if (err < 0)
 					return err;
 			}
@@ -1610,19 +1610,19 @@
 	return 0;
 }
 
-static int tcp_show_netlink(struct filter *f, FILE *dump_fp, int socktype)
+static int inet_show_netlink(struct filter *f, FILE *dump_fp, int socktype)
 {
 	int err = 0;
 
 	if (f->families & (1 << AF_INET))
-		err |= __tcp_show_netlink(f, dump_fp, AF_INET, socktype);
+		err |= __inet_show_netlink(f, dump_fp, AF_INET, socktype);
 	if (f->families & (1 << AF_INET6))
-		err |= __tcp_show_netlink(f, dump_fp, AF_INET6, socktype);
+		err |= __inet_show_netlink(f, dump_fp, AF_INET6, socktype);
 
 	return err;
 }
 
-static int tcp_show_netlink_file(struct filter *f)
+static int inet_show_netlink_file(struct filter *f)
 {
 	FILE	*fp;
 	char	buf[8192];
@@ -1672,7 +1672,7 @@
 			return -1;
 		}
 
-		err = tcp_show_sock(h, f);
+		err = inet_show_sock(h, f);
 		if (err < 0)
 			return err;
 	}
@@ -1687,10 +1687,10 @@
 	dg_proto = TCP_PROTO;
 
 	if (getenv("TCPDIAG_FILE"))
-		return tcp_show_netlink_file(f);
+		return inet_show_netlink_file(f);
 
 	if (!getenv("PROC_NET_TCP") && !getenv("PROC_ROOT")
-	    && tcp_show_netlink(f, NULL, socktype) == 0)
+	    && inet_show_netlink(f, NULL, socktype) == 0)
 		return 0;
 
 	/* Sigh... We have to parse /proc/net/tcp... */
@@ -1852,6 +1852,15 @@
 {
 	FILE *fp = NULL;
 
+	if (getenv("TCPDIAG_FILE"))
+		return inet_show_netlink_file(f);
+
+	if (!getenv("PROC_NET_TCP") && !getenv("PROC_ROOT")
+	    && inet_show_netlink(f, NULL, IPPROTO_UDP) == 0)
+		return 0;
+
+	/* legacy proc files parse */
+
 	dg_proto = UDP_PROTO;
 
 	if (f->families&(1<<AF_INET)) {
@@ -2787,7 +2796,7 @@
 
 	if (dump_tcpdiag) {
 		FILE *dump_fp = stdout;
-		if (!(current_filter.dbs & (1<<TCP_DB))) {
+		if (!(current_filter.dbs & ((1<<TCP_DB) | (1<<UDP_DB)))) {
 			fprintf(stderr, "ss: tcpdiag dump requested and no tcp in filter.\n");
 			exit(0);
 		}
@@ -2798,7 +2807,13 @@
 				exit(-1);
 			}
 		}
-		tcp_show_netlink(&current_filter, dump_fp, IPPROTO_TCP);
+
+		if (current_filter.dbs & (1<<UDP_DB))
+			inet_show_netlink(&current_filter, dump_fp, IPPROTO_UDP);
+
+		if (current_filter.dbs & (1<<TCP_DB))
+			inet_show_netlink(&current_filter, dump_fp, IPPROTO_TCP);
+
 		fflush(dump_fp);
 		exit(0);
 	}
